A career in cloud computing is centered around fostering long-term relationships and collaborative partnerships with clients worldwide.
Job Description
We are seeking an experienced Java developer to contribute to the development of cutting-edge cloud solutions on Amazon Web Services (AWS).
Key Responsibilities
* Design, Develop, and Deploy Scalable Cloud Applications: Utilize Java and AWS technologies to create secure and efficient cloud-based applications.
* Collaborate with Cross-Functional Teams: Identify business requirements and implement technical solutions through collaboration with cross-functional teams.
* Participate in Code Reviews: Ensure high-quality code standards and drive continuous improvement initiatives.
* Analyze Complex Problems: Provide innovative solutions and optimize system performance by analyzing complex problems.
Requirements
* Minimum 5 Years of Experience: In Java development with a strong focus on cloud computing and AWS.
* AWS Services Expertise: Hands-on experience with AWS services including S3, Lambda, API Gateway, and DynamoDB.
* Excellent Problem-Solving Skills: Ability to analyze complex systems and optimize performance.
* Strong Communication Skills: Experience working in agile development environments with strong communication skills.
Preferred Qualifications
* DevOps Tools Experience: Experience with DevOps tools such as Jenkins, Docker, and Kubernetes.
* Containerization Knowledge: Knowledge of containerization and orchestration techniques.
* Agile Methodologies Familiarity: Familiarity with Agile methodologies and Scrum framework.
* Fast-Paced Environment Expertise: Ability to work in a fast-paced environment with multiple priorities and deadlines.